WESTERN NORTH ATLANTIC. DNC 17, DNC 18. POSSIBLE MAN OVERBOARD FROM VESSEL QUEEN MARY TWO IN VICINITY OF TRACKLINE BETWEEN 41-32.4N 059-50.8W AND 40-46.6N 066-46.1W.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O RCC BOSTON, PHONE: 617 223 8555, E-MAIL: [email protected].
- 2HYDROLANT 1748/172017-06-02 21:30Z → cancelled 2017-06-02 21:30Z (archive)Cancel HYDROLANT 1710/17 and this msg, search suspendedresolved
WESTERN NORTH ATLANTIC. DNC 17, DNC 18. CANCEL HYDROLANT 1710/17 AND THIS MSG, SEARCH SUSPENDED.
